Malfunctioning Thermostats

A thermostat that isn’t working correctly can prevent your heating system from operating at optimal efficiency. Symptoms may include inconsistent temperatures throughout the home or the heating system failing to turn on or off as scheduled. For instance, if you set your thermostat to 72°F, but the room temperature remains significantly lower, this is a clear indication of a potential thermostat malfunction.

Clogged Filters

Clogged air filters can severely impact the efficiency of your heating system. Often overlooked, these filters trap dust and debris but need regular replacement to maintain airflow. Symptoms of a clogged filter may include reduced airflow, strange noises from the heating unit, and a noticeable increase in energy bills. A dirty filter can cause the system to work harder, leading to wear and tear over time.

Issues with the Heat Exchanger

The heat exchanger plays a critical role in your heating system’s operation by transferring heat from combustion gases to the air circulating in your home. If the heat exchanger is cracked or leaking, it poses serious safety risks, including carbon monoxide exposure. Symptoms of a failing heat exchanger can include unusual smells, noticeable soot buildup, and the presence of moisture near the heating unit.

In severe cases, a malfunctioning heat exchanger can lead to system shutdown for safety reasons.

Common Costs Associated with Various Repair Services

When considering AC heating repairs, it’s helpful to be aware of the common services and their associated costs. Below is a breakdown of typical repair services and their estimated price ranges:

Repair Type Estimated Cost
Thermostat Replacement $100 – $300
Refrigerant Recharge $150 – $400
Compressor Repair/Replacement $500 – $2,500
Fan Motor Replacement $300 – $600
Electrical Component Repair $150 – $800

These costs can vary based on the specific circumstances of each repair, such as the make and model of the unit and the geographic location of the service.

Factors Influencing Repair Costs

Various factors can significantly impact the costs associated with AC heating repair. Understanding these can help you make informed decisions and potentially save money:

  • Age of the Unit: Older systems may require more frequent repairs and may have parts that are harder to find, driving costs higher.
  • Extent of Damage: Minor repairs will naturally cost less than extensive system malfunctions that require multiple components to be replaced.
  • Labor Rates: The costs of labor can vary widely by region and the technician’s level of expertise, affecting the total repair expense.
  • Type of Repair: Routine maintenance is generally less expensive than emergency repairs, which may involve overtime charges.
  • Availability of Parts: If specific parts need to be ordered, this can extend repair times and add to total costs.

Maintenance Schedule for AC Heating Systems

Establishing a consistent maintenance schedule is fundamental to ensuring your AC heating system remains efficient and reliable. Here’s a recommended timeline:

  • Monthly:
    • Check the air filter and replace it if it’s dirty. A clean filter ensures proper airflow and improves efficiency.
  • Seasonally (Fall and Spring):
    • Inspect the thermostat to ensure accurate settings and operation.
    • Examine ductwork for signs of leaks and seal any gaps to enhance efficiency.
  • Annually:
    • Schedule a professional inspection and tune-up to ensure all components are functioning optimally.
    • Clean the outdoor unit and remove debris to maintain airflow.

Importance of Energy Efficiency Ratings in Systems

Energy efficiency ratings serve as benchmarks that help consumers choose the right heating system for their needs. These ratings provide valuable information regarding the efficiency of various models, helping to make informed decisions. A few key aspects of energy efficiency ratings include:

  • Seasonal Energy Efficiency Ratio (SEER): This rating measures the cooling output during a typical cooling season divided by the total electric energy input during the same period, helping gauge efficiency.
  • Annual Fuel Utilization Efficiency (AFUE): This indicates how efficiently a furnace converts fuel into heat over a year, with higher numbers showing greater efficiency.
  • Energy Guide Labels: These labels give insight into the expected annual costs of operating a unit, aiding in the comparison of different models.

Step-by-Step Guide for Troubleshooting Heating Problems

Start by familiarizing yourself with your heating system and its components. This knowledge will help you pinpoint problems more effectively. Here are essential steps to follow when troubleshooting:

1. Check the Thermostat Settings

Ensure that the thermostat is set to ‘heat’ and the desired temperature is higher than the current room temperature.

2. Inspect the Power Supply

Make sure the system is receiving power. Check circuit breakers and fuses to ensure they are in working order.

3. Examine Air Filters

Dirty air filters can restrict airflow, leading to inefficiency. Replace or clean filters as necessary.

4. Inspect Vents and Registers

Ensure that vents are open and unobstructed. Blocked ducts can cause uneven heating throughout the home.

5. Listen for Unusual Noises

Strange sounds may indicate mechanical issues. Take note of any clicking, buzzing, or rattling noises.

6. Check for Leaks

Inspect the system for any visible leaks, especially in ductwork or around the furnace.

7. Observe System Behavior

Monitor the system’s operation over a period of time. If it cycles on and off frequently, or fails to reach the set temperature, further investigation may be needed.

FAQ Insights

What are common signs that my heating system needs repair?

Common signs include unusual noises, inconsistent heating, increased energy bills, and the presence of strange odors.

Can I perform heating repairs myself?

While some minor maintenance tasks can be done DIY, it is advisable to seek professional help for complex repairs to avoid safety risks.

How often should I have my heating system serviced?

It is recommended to have your heating system serviced at least once a year to ensure optimal performance and prevent issues.

What factors can affect the cost of heating repairs?

Factors include the type of repair needed, the age of the system, labor costs, and the availability of parts.

What are the benefits of a maintenance agreement with a service provider?

A maintenance agreement often includes regular check-ups, priority service, and discounts on repairs, helping to ensure your system is always in good working condition.
